What do you observe in others, does marriage improve "successful aging" in men? Study summary: + Marriage boosts successful aging in men + Minimal impact on women + sSocial ties crucial for aging well, esp post widowhood or divorce.

this is interesting: "Among women, those who had never married were twice as likely to age optimally compared to married respondents who became widowed or divorced during the study period. Married women did not differ significantly from never-married women with respect to optimal aging."
